I have a 94 Jetta GLS III. The diagnostic port is located to the right of the ash tray, with an OBD-II connector. According to the OBD-II website it has the ISO pinout. I've tried a couple of different code readers and they can't pull the codes (probably because they were OBD-II readers). When I tried the expensive reader the Check Engine Light flashed 3 three times before the code reader timed out.

From what I've been told, there's two pins to jump to be able to pull the codes. Which pins do I jump? Also, how would I clear the codes?
